Militarism, Alliances, Imperialism, Nationalism
M.A.I.N. is a good way to remember the causes of WWI. Militarism was growing in Europe at the time as countries were building up and modernizing their militaries with new technology. Alliances were a cause since countries signed agreements to support each other in the event of conflict. Imperialism was growing as European powers were competing for colonies and resources in Africa and Asia. Nationalism is the last cause because European countries were growing in their national pride and sense of power. These MAIN causes acted as a powder keg that simply needed a spark to ignite.
